Life actuarial analyst role within an Actuarial Development Program focused on life and annuity valuation, product development, ALM and risk tasks. Responsibilities include GAAP/statutory reserving, pricing and product filings, AXIS-based asset modeling, and cross-functional project work. Hiring in Rosemont, IL for Analyst or Senior Analyst levels.
JOB DESCRIPTION SUMMARY
- Support life and annuity valuation on GAAP, statutory, and tax bases
- Assist product pricing, NGE rate setting, and actuarial memoranda for filings
- Build and run financial projection models and ALM/hedging support in AXIS
- Produce monthly management reporting and monitor product experience
- Participate in cross-functional projects and stakeholder management
